Product Description:

Bosch Rexroth Indramat produces the MSK100B-0400-NN-M2-BG1-RNNN as part of the MSK IndraDyn S Synchronous Motors series. This IndraDyn S synchronous servomotor functions as a rotary actuator that provides precise torque output and position feedback for automated machine axes. By combining a compact housing with high-resolution feedback, the unit is used in packaging lines, metal-cutting centers, and material-handling stations where deterministic motion is required. Its synchronous design supports controlled acceleration and repeatable positioning on servo-driven equipment.

The stator windings are cooled by natural convection, removing heat through the housing without external fans. A housing protection rating of IP65 seals the frame against dust ingress and low-pressure water jets so the motor can be mounted near the working process. Position data are transmitted through the EnDat2.1 interface, and the optical sensor inside the encoder produces 2048 signal periods per revolution for fine incremental positioning. An electrically released holding brake supplies 32 Nm of static torque to lock the shaft during power-off conditions, and the power connector is arranged on the motor's B-side to keep cabling parallel with the machine bed. Increased concentricity machining minimizes radial runout and vibration.

The feedback device stores rotational count information in multi-turn absolute format, eliminating homing cycles after shutdown. A plain shaft transfers torque through a clamped coupling, and the dimensional code corresponds to motor size 100 with length class B for higher continuous power than shorter variants. The unit operates within 0–40 °C ambient limits, matching typical industrial conditions. Insulation system 155 permits winding temperatures up to 155 °C before thermal derating begins, while winding code 0400 indicates the electrical characteristics used by the matching drive to calculate current limits.
